Multiple Room Audio in Stereo using a HAL3s

This system provides music in stereo for three separate zones. Applications include hotels, multifunction rooms or distributed stereo in homes. These are the requirements:

  • There are two audio sources: a radio receiver and a cable receiver.
  • The three rooms need individual source selection and volume within each.

This can be accomplished with:

  • (1) HAL3s Multiprocessor
  • (1) RAD6 for the second input, in this case a cable box.
  • (3) DR3 Remotes in each room to adjust source and volume.
  • The system can use either powered speakers, amplifiers and speakers, or a combination of both.
  • Optional Windows® PC running Halogen may be used to fine-tune volumes and other settings.

3-zone stereo background music system

All of the DSP required for distributed background music selection, room equalization, speaker protection and Level control is included in the HAL3s. Each of the three outputs has a limiter to protect the speaker, and each zone is preset with a maximum loudness. Parametric equalizers are used in the example, though 30-band graphic equalizers can replace these or be added.

The RAD6 is used here only to provide a second stereo source. If only a receiver is used, and the music source is centrally switched from that, the RAD6 can be removed, and DR1 remotes can be used to control room volume.
